#a6b6b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6b6b4 is composed of 65.1% red, 71.4%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 172.5 degrees, a saturation of 9.9% and a lightness of 68.2%. #a6b6b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d6d69.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a6b6b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6b6b4 has RGB values of R:166, G:182,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10925748.
